Understanding the Pakistani Freelance Ecosystem

Freelancing in Pakistan is an ever-growing industry, but it comes with its unique challenges. Many freelancers face hurdles such as payment gateway restrictions, fierce competition, and lack of visibility. However, by leveraging platforms like Upwork, you can overcome these challenges and connect with premium clients worldwide.

One crucial thing to note is that PayPal does not work in Pakistan. This limitation makes it vital to have alternative payment solutions. Upwork supports payments through Payoneer and Wise, both of which are reliable options for Pakistani freelancers.

Components of a Winning Proposal

A successful proposal is not just about showcasing your skills; it’s also about understanding the client's needs and demonstrating how you can fulfill them. Here’s a breakdown of essential components in your graphic design proposal:

1. Personalized Greeting

Start your proposal with a warm and personalized greeting. Use the client’s name if available; this shows you’ve taken the time to read their job posting.

2. Introduction

In this section, briefly introduce yourself. Mention your name, experience, and specialty in graphic design. For example:

"Hello [Client's Name],
My name is Ahmed, and I am a graphic designer with over 5 years of experience in creating compelling visual identities for brands. I specialize in logo design, branding, and social media graphics."

3. Understanding the Project

Show that you’ve understood the project requirements. Summarize what the client needs and how you plan to address those needs. For instance:

"I understand that you are looking for a logo that reflects your brand’s mission of sustainability and innovation. I believe I can create a design that embodies these values."

4. Showcase Your Work

Provide links to your portfolio or attach relevant samples of your work. Make sure these examples align with the project requirements. This is your chance to wow the client!

5. Proposed Solution

Outline how you plan to execute the project. This section should detail your design process, timelines, and what the client can expect at each stage. For example:

"My design process typically involves three stages: concept development, feedback, and finalization. I aim to complete the initial concepts within three days, after which I will seek your feedback to refine the design."

6. Budget and Timeline

Be transparent about your pricing and estimated timeline. Providing a clear structure can build trust with the client. You might say:

"I propose a budget of $150 for this project, with an expected completion time of one week."

7. Call to Action

Encourage the client to take the next step. A simple request for a chat or to discuss the project further can be effective. For example:

"I would love to discuss your project in more detail. Please let me know a convenient time for you to chat!"

Practical Steps to Create Your Proposal

Here’s a step-by-step guide to crafting your proposal:

  1. Read the Job Description Thoroughly: Understand what the client is looking for.
  2. Research the Client: Check their previous work and feedback to tailor your approach.
  3. Use the Template Above: Customize it according to the job requirements.
  4. Proofread: Ensure that your proposal is free of grammatical errors and typos.
  5. Submit Early: Try to submit your proposal as soon as possible to increase visibility.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I start working on Upwork from Pakistan?

Create an Upwork account, complete your profile, take skills tests, and start sending proposals. Take some jobs at lower rates initially to build reviews.

What are the best Upwork jobs for Pakistanis?

Web development, graphic design, content writing, SEO, virtual assistant, and data entry are the best categories for Pakistani freelancers.

What are Upwork connects and how many do I need?

Connects are Upwork's currency for sending proposals. You get 10 free connects monthly. New freelancers should send 3-5 quality proposals daily.
